About Hendricks Live!
Hendricks Live! is a dynamic nonprofit arts and entertainment venue dedicated to creating memorable experiences for Central Indiana’s diverse communities. Through performances, events, and community engagement, we bring people together through exceptional art and entertainment.
Located just 30 minutes from Indianapolis in the growing and vibrant town of Plainfield, Hendricks Live! features:
· A 600-seat performance theatre
· A 900 sq ft event space with additional 600 sq ft terrace
· Ample lobby space
· Public art galleries
Our programming includes concerts, theatre, dance, comedy, film, and community events, alongside private rentals such as weddings, corporate events, and fundraisers.

What You’ll Do
Event Planning & Management
· Serve as primary project manager and client contact for rental events following contract execution through event completion.
· Conduct planning meetings, site visits, and venue walkthroughs.
· Develop and maintain event timelines, layouts, event packets, contact lists, and operational plans.
· Coordinate all event logistics including room setups, vendor access, load-in/load-out schedules, catering, bar service, registration, auctions, sponsorship activations, and guest flow.
· Coordinate event information with clients, vendors, HL staff, TOP staff, and other stakeholders.
· Ensure assigned events are delivered according to contractual obligations and client expectations.
· Develop event settlements and closeout documentation as required.
· Identify opportunities to upsell venue services, rental enhancements, bar packages, production elements, staffing, and other event add-ons.
Event Execution & Operations
· Advance, plan, and execute assigned events unless otherwise delegated.
· Serve as Manager on Duty (MOD) for assigned events as scheduled.
· Act as primary escalation point for client, vendor, and operational concerns during assigned events.
· Provide day-to-day leadership, training, and supervision of Event Assistants and assigned event support staff.
· Troubleshoot and resolve issues in real time to ensure successful event outcomes.
· Conduct post-event evaluations and identify opportunities for continuous improvement.
Private Bar Operations
· Manage private bar services for rental events.
· Coordinate client bar selections and service requirements.
· Create bar contracts, inventory plans, and event-specific service plans.
· Manage bar inventory, ordering, tracking, and reconciliation.
· Coordinate bar staffing and event execution.
· Ensure compliance with alcohol service policies and operational procedures.
· Coordinate with Guest Services when concessions services are requested or required for rental events.
